Suggest Remedy To Relieve Pain And Bleeding Due To Adenomyosis

Im 40 years old and have recently been diagnosed with adenomyosis (after previously thinking i had fibroids for five years) after a MRI pelvis scan. It has gotten so severe now with the bleeding and pain that I am now on the waiting list to have a hysterectomy. I started off on three iron tablets five years ago, then it went down to two and now I am on one a day.I am been taking Tranexamic acid tablets during my periods but I do not think they are effective now. I am intolerant to mefanamic tablets so take co-codomol instead which do not seem to work well as i still feel pain. I have tried a variety of oral contraception and had the mirena coil but they made it all the worse. I have been reading up and researching as much as I can about this condition and heavy and painful periods in general. It seems to me that a common factor is too much estrogen and not enough progesterone. It also seems to me that diet plays a part in having abnormal periods and have embarked on a new food plan which I started about nine days ago. I have cut out sweets, crisps, chocolate, cakes, pastries, processed and refined foods and replaced them with unrefined, organic and wholegrain food such as brown rice,oatmeal, weetabix, veg, fruit, fish,nuts and seeds, dates and at least one and a half litres of water a day and am not craving any of my 'old' foods. I don't know if this will help the condition but I am hoping so. What do you think?
